Early acting career First movie Breakthrough

Katherine Boyer Waterston was born in Westminster, London, England, on March 3, 1980, is a British-American actress.

Young Katherine Waterston began her professional acting career on the stage.

She made her big screen debut in legal thriller film Michael Clayton (2007) in role as Third Year.

She got her television debut in HBO period crime drama series Boardwalk Empire (2012-2013) in role as Emma Harrow.

Katherine's breakthrough performance came as Shasta Fay Hepworth in neo-noir crime film Inherent Vice (2014).

Best Movies

She played Porpentina "Tina" Goldste in fantasy movies:

Fantastic Beasts and Where to Find Them (2016), for which she was nominated for the Teen Choice Award for Choice Fantasy Movie Actress

Fantastic Beasts: The Crimes of Grindelwald (2018), for which she was nominated for the Teen Choice Award for Choice Sci-Fi / Fantasy Movie Actress

Fantastic Beasts: The Secrets of Dumbledore (2022)

She was nominated for the Satellite Award for Best Supporting Actress in a Motion Picture for her role as Shasta Fay Hepworth in neo-noir crime film Inherent Vice (2014).

She was nominated for the Circuit Community Award for Best Cast Ensemble for her role as Chrisann Brennan in biographical drama film Steve Jobs (2015).

She was nominated for the Chlotrudis Award for Best Supporting Actress for her performance as Virginia in psychological thriller movie Queen of Earth (2015).

She won the Stockholm International Film Festival Award for Best Actress and was nominated for the Faro Island Film Festival Award for Best Performance by an Actress in a Leading Role for her role as Abigail in drama movie The World to Come (2020).

She was nominated for the Screen Actors Guild Award for Outstanding Performance by a Cast in a Motion Picture for her role as Estelle in epic period black comedy drama film Babylon (2022).

Best TV Shows

She played Emma Harrow in HBO period crime drama television series Boardwalk Empire (2012-2013) in 5 episodes.

She portrayed Jess in HBO and Sky Atlantic psychological thriller–folk horror drama television miniseries The Third Day (2020).

Facts

Graduated from the Loomis Chaffee School in 1998.

Graduated from the Tisch School of the Arts at New York University, with BFA in Acting.

Has older sister Elisabeth, brother, Graham and half brother, James.

Has English and Scottish ancestry.

She voiced Tina Goldstein in video game Lego Dimensions (2016).

She played Frances in a play "Kindness" (2008), at Playwrights Horizons.

She portrayed Gena in a play "Bachelorette" (2010), at McGinn/Cazale Theatre.

Has one son.

Lives in New York City, New York, United States.
